Make it a lifestyle

I can't stress enough the importance of health and wellness being a lifestyle.  I hear all the time how people have started fad diets like Atkins or South Beach with the intent of just "losing the weight".  People want a quick way to shed pounds and then they'll go to eating "the right way."  This RARELY works and quite frankly isn't good for you!  I'm not a registered dietitian, so please don't take this is professional advice, but simply what has worked for me and what I've seen others fail at again and again. 

You have to make a choice - a choice to eat healthy, incorporate things into your life that make you more active, and things that make you feel whole.  Being healthy isn't about looking like the latest swimsuit cover model because let's face it, she probably doesn't even look that way! But it also isn't what a lot of companies and individuals are promoting as "the new healthy."  Why should it be acceptable to be overweight?  Why shouldn't we want to be healthier so that we can feel better, be more productive, and lead longer lives?  Yes, we should learn to love our bodies for all of their imperfections.  I'm healthy, but I also enjoy eating certain foods and drinking a good glass of wine at the end of the day.  Doing those things means I'm probably sacrificing that washboard stomach I'd like to have.  But I've made a choice.  I'm happy with the way that I look because I feel great, have tons of energy, and am taking care of my body, mind, and soul.
